Tanzania - Import of Calcium Phosphates
Since 2014, Tanzania Import of Calcium Phosphates grew 127%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 102 among other countries in Import of Calcium Phosphates at $282,771.78. Tanzania is overtaken by Morocco, which was ranked number 101 with $301,126.4 and is followed by Oman with $237,146.85. United States lead the ranking with $96,867,850.98 in 2019, that is an increase of 2% compared to 2018. Germany, Poland and Belgium resp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Armenia witnessed the best average annual growth at +201% per year, while Barbados recorded the worst performance at -49.5% per year.

Date | US Dollars |
---|---|
2019 | 282,771.78 |
2018 | 326,625.09 |
2017 | 130,449.00 |
2016 | 58,588.00 |
2015 | 54,446.00 |
